Auf dieser Seite finden Sie Versionshinweise zur AdSense Management API.
Version 2
In dieser Version werden die folgenden Änderungen eingeführt, um eingestellte Funktionen zu entfernen und die AdSense Management API an die aktuellen Google-API-Standards anzupassen. Gemäß dem Google-API-Versionsschema wird diese Version im Laufe der Zeit aktualisiert, um zusätzliche (abwärtskompatible) Funktionen zu enthalten. Neue Funktionen werden nicht in separaten Nebenversionen veröffentlicht.
2025-10-02
Berichte
- Die Dimension 
TRAFFIC_SOURCEwurde hinzugefügt. Damit lassen sich Messwerte nach Zugriffsquelle aufschlüsseln, z. B. „Google“, „Bing“, „Facebook“ oder „Andere“. Weitere Informationen finden Sie unter Aufschlüsselung nach Traffic-Quelle. 
2025-05-06
PolicyIssues
- Das eingestellte Feld 
policyTopics[].must_fix(siehe vorherige Aktualisierung) wird jetzt immer auffalsegesetzt. 
2025-02-24
PolicyIssues
- Es wurde ein 
policyTopics[].type-Feld hinzugefügt, um anzugeben, ob ein Richtlinienthema ein Richtlinienproblem, ein rechtliches Problem oder eine Einstellung des Werbetreibenden darstellt. Dieses Feld ersetztpolicyTopics[].must_fix, das jetzt als verworfenes Feld markiert ist. 
2024-04-03
PolicyIssues
- Es wurde eine neue Sammlung hinzugefügt, mit der Sie Berichte zu aktuellen Richtlinienverstößen und Warnungen für ein Konto erstellen können.
 
2023-06-19
Zahlungen
- Mit payments.list werden jetzt Details zu Zahlungen für Premium-Publisher zurückgegeben.
 
2023-06-13
Berichte
- Die Messwerte 
FUNNEL_REQUESTS,FUNNEL_IMPRESSIONS,FUNNEL_CLICKSundFUNNEL_RPMwurden hinzugefügt. Sie liefern Informationen zur Leistung von Anzeigenblöcken, die keine Anzeigen enthalten, z. B. Einheiten für die zugehörige Suche. 
2023-03-30
Berichte
- Die Dimension 
PAGE_URLwurde hinzugefügt. Damit lassen sich Messwerte nach Seiten-URL aufschlüsseln (mit einigen Einschränkungen, siehe Aufschlüsselung nach Seiten-URL). 
2022-09-21
AdUnits
- Die Methoden „create“ und „patch“ wurden hinzugefügt. Diese Methoden können nur für Projekte verwendet werden, für die das Produkt AdSense für Plattformen aktiviert ist.
 
CustomChannels
- Die Methoden „create“, „patch“ und „update“ wurden hinzugefügt. Diese Methoden können nur für Projekte verwendet werden, für die das Produkt AdSense für Plattformen aktiviert ist.
 - Der Ressource wurde das Feld „active“ hinzugefügt.
 
Konten
- Die Methode „getAdBlockingRecoveryTag“ wurde hinzugefügt.
 
2022-08-25
Berichte
- Die Dimension 
HOSTED_AD_CLIENT_IDwurde hinzugefügt. Damit können Host- und Plattformpublisher Messwerte nach den Konten ihrer Publisher (Host-Publisher) und nach Unterkonten (Plattformpublisher) aufschlüsseln. 
2022-05-03
AdClient
- Die Methode „get“ wurde hinzugefügt.
 
Berichte
- Die Methode „getSaved“ wurde hinzugefügt.
 
UrlChannels
- Die Methode „get“ wurde hinzugefügt.
 
2022-03-31
Konto
- Inaktive Konten werden jetzt von der API zurückgegeben. Das Feld 
stategibt den Status des Kontos an. 
AdClient
- Ähnlich wie bei den Kontoänderungen werden inaktive AdSense-Clients jetzt von der API zurückgegeben. Das Feld 
stategibt den Status des AdSense-Clients an. 
2022-02-24
Zahlung
- 
    Das Format der Ressourcennamen wurde erweitert, um separate Ressourcen für YouTube-Einnahmen zu unterstützen. Diese Änderung erfolgt vor der schrittweisen Einführung der verbesserten AdSense-Nutzung für YouTube-Creator, bei der YouTube-Einnahmen in einem separaten Zahlungskonto ausgewiesen werden. YouTube-Zahlungsinformationen werden auch über die Methode „payments.list“ zurückgegeben, sobald du ein eigenes Zahlungskonto für YouTube-Einnahmen hast.
    YouTube-Einnahmen haben das folgende Ressourcenname-Format:
    
- accounts/{account}/payments/youtube-unpaid für nicht ausgezahlte (aktuelle) YouTube-Einnahmen.
 - accounts/{account}/payments/youtube-yyyy-MM-dd für bezahlte YouTube-Einnahmen.
 
Hinweis:Die Ressourcennamen für AdSense-Einnahmen bleiben unverändert:- accounts/{account}/payments/unpaid für ausstehende (aktuelle) AdSense-Einnahmen.
 - accounts/{account}/payments/yyyy-MM-dd für bezahlte AdSense-Einnahmen.
 
 
2021-06-30
Bericht
- Die Dimensionen 
AD_FORMAT_NAMEundAD_FORMAT_CODEwurden hinzugefügt. Sie geben an, wie eine Anzeige Nutzern auf Ihrer Website präsentiert wird (z. B. auf der Seite oder als Vignette). In Version 1.4 gab es Dimensionen mit denselben Namen, aber unterschiedlichen Elementen. Die beiden in Version 2 hinzugefügten Dimensionen unterscheiden sich von denen in Version 1.4. 
19.04.2021 (Erste Version)
Allgemein
- Alle veralteten Methoden in Version 1.4 wurden entfernt. Dazu gehören Ressourcenmethoden, für die kein 
accountIderforderlich war. In Version 2 wird dieaccountIdim Feldparentangegeben. - Gemäß den Google API-Standards werden Ressourcen jetzt durch das Feld 
nameidentifiziert. Der Name eines AdClient-Objekts würde beispielsweise so aussehen:accounts/{accountId}/adclients/{adClientId}. Außerdem wurde in Version 1.4 die Ressourcen-ID als Berichtsdimension verwendet. In Version 2 ist dieser Wert jetzt über das Feldreporting_dimension_idfür mehrere Ressourcen verfügbar. - Das Feld 
kindwurde aus allen Ressourcen entfernt. 
Konto
- Das Feld 
namewurde indisplay_namegeändert. - Das Feld 
timezonewurde von einem String zu einemgoogle.type.TimeZonegeändert. - Das Feld 
creation_time(Typ „int64“) wurde increate_time(Typgoogle.protobuf.Timestamp) geändert. - Das Feld 
pending_taskswurde hinzugefügt. Es enthält eine Liste der ausstehenden Aufgaben, die im Rahmen der Registrierung für ein neues Konto erledigt werden müssen. Aufgaben können sich beispielsweise auf Ihr Abrechnungsprofil oder die Telefonbestätigung beziehen. - Das Feld 
sub_accountswurde entfernt. Eine ähnliche Funktion kann in Version 2 mit der benutzerdefinierten MethodelistChildAccountserreicht werden. Der vollständige Baum des untergeordneten Kontos kann in Version 2 durch rekursives Aufrufen vonlistChildAccountsgeneriert werden. 
AdClient
- Das Feld 
arc_opt_inwurde entfernt, da es bereits aus der AdSense-Benutzeroberfläche entfernt wurde. - Das Feld 
supports_reportingwird durch das Feldreporting_dimension_idersetzt, das die eindeutige ID des Anzeigenclients darstellt, wie sie in der BerichtsdimensionAD_CLIENT_IDverwendet wird. Wennreporting_dimension_idleer ist, unterstützt der AdClient keine Berichterstellung. 
AdUnit
- Das Feld 
statuswurde instateumbenannt. Außerdem gibt der StatusACTIVEnicht mehr an, ob in den letzten sieben Tagen Aktivitäten für diesen Anzeigenblock stattgefunden haben. In Version 2 bedeutet das, dass der Anzeigenblock vom Nutzer aktiviert wurde und Anzeigen ausgeliefert werden können. - Das Feld 
codewurde entfernt. Dieser Wert ist weiterhin am Ende des Feldsname(nach dem letzten Schrägstrich) zu finden. - Das Feld 
contentAdsSettings.backupOptionwurde entfernt. - Das Feld 
typeist auf die WerteTYPE_UNSPECIFIED,DISPLAY,FEED,ARTICLE,MATCHED_CONTENTundLINKbeschränkt. - Andere Felder, die bereits aus der AdSense-Benutzeroberfläche entfernt wurden, werden ebenfalls entfernt: 
custom_style,saved_style_id,mobile_content_ads_settings,feed_ads_settings. 
Benachrichtigung
- Die Methode 
deletewurde entfernt. - Das Feld 
is_dismissiblewurde entfernt. - Das Feld 
localewurde inlanguage_codeumbenannt. 
CustomChannel
- Das Feld 
codewurde entfernt. Dieser Wert ist weiterhin am Ende des Feldsname(nach dem letzten Schrägstrich) zu finden. - Das Feld 
targeting_infowurde entfernt, da es bereits aus der AdSense-Benutzeroberfläche entfernt wurde. 
Zahlung
- Das Feld 
payment_datewurde indateumbenannt und der Typ wurde von „String“ ingoogle.type.Dategeändert. - Das Feld 
payment_amountund das Feldpayment_amount_currency_codewurden in einem einzigen Feldpaymentzusammengefasst (z.B. „¥1.235 JPY“, „$1.234,57“, „£87,65“). 
Bericht
- In Version 2 stimmen die Berichtsdaten der AdSense Management API jetzt mit der AdSense-Benutzeroberfläche überein. Das bedeutet, dass AdMob- und YouTube-Properties nicht mehr unterstützt werden. Außerdem werden in der API nur Berichtsdaten der letzten drei Jahre unterstützt.
 - Die Ressource 
Metadata.dimensionsund die RessourceMetadata.metricswurden entfernt. - Es wurden neue Methoden zum Generieren einer CSV-Version des Berichts hinzugefügt, die die Abfrageparameter in Version 1.4 ersetzen. Hinweis: Für die Komprimierung können Sie weiterhin den HTTP-Header „Accept-Encoding: gzip“ verwenden.
 - 
    Einige Felder wurden bei der Erstellung von Ad-hoc-Berichten geändert.
    
- Das Feld 
account_idwurde inaccountumbenannt. - Das Feld 
dimensionwurde indimensionsumbenannt. - Das Feld 
metricwurde inmetricsumbenannt. - Das Feld 
filterwurde infiltersumbenannt. - Das Feld 
sortwurde inorder_byumbenannt. - Das Feld 
localewurde inlanguage_codeumbenannt. - Das Feld 
currencywurde incurrency_codeumbenannt. - Sie können jetzt mehrere gemeinsame Bereiche mit 
date_rangeangeben (z.B.TODAY,YESTERDAY,MONTH_TO_DATE,YEAR_TO_DATE,LAST_7_DAYSundLAST_30_DAYS) oder Sie könnenstart_dateundend_dateangeben, indem Siedate_rangeaufCUSTOMfestlegen. - Die Felder 
start_dateundend_datewurden vom Typ „String“ in den Typgoogle.type.Dategeändert. Hinweis: Daher werden relative Datums-Keywords (z.B. „today-6d“) werden nicht mehr unterstützt. - Das boolesche Feld 
use_timezone_reportingwurde durchreporting_time_zoneersetzt, das einen von zwei Werten haben kann:ACCOUNT_TIME_ZONEoderGOOGLE_TIME_ZONE(was PST/PDT bedeutet). Der Standardwert in Version 2 istACCOUNT_TIME_ZONE. Das unterscheidet sich vom Standardwert in Version 1.4. - Das Feld 
start_indexwurde entfernt. - Das Feld 
max_resultswurde inlimitumbenannt. 
 - Das Feld 
 - 
  Einige Felder wurden bei der Generierung gespeicherter Berichte geändert.
    
- Datumsfelder hinzugefügt (
date_range,start_date,end_date,reporting_time_zone). - Das Feld 
currency_codewurde hinzugefügt. - Das Feld 
localewurde inlanguage_codeumbenannt. - Das Feld 
start_indexwurde entfernt. - Das Feld 
max_resultswurde entfernt. 
 - Datumsfelder hinzugefügt (
 
SavedAdStyle
SavedAdStylewurde entfernt, da es bereits aus der AdSense-Benutzeroberfläche entfernt wurde.
Website
- 
    
Siteswurden hinzugefügt, um Daten zu Websites abzurufen, die Sie Ihrem AdSense-Konto hinzugefügt haben. - Das Feld 
stategibt an, ob sich die Website in einem der folgenden Status befindet:REQUIRES_REVIEW,GETTING_READY,READY,NEEDS_ATTENTION. - Das Feld 
auto_ads_enabledist ein boolescher Wert, der angibt, ob automatische Anzeigen auf einer bestimmten Website aktiviert wurden. 
Version 1.4
In dieser Version werden die folgenden Funktionen eingeführt:
- Sie können jetzt die Zahlungen für Ihr AdSense-Konto in der entsprechenden Währung auflisten.
 - Sie können jetzt eine Benachrichtigung schließen, indem Sie die Methode 
deleteaufrufen. Dadurch wird die Benachrichtigung in der API und in der AdSense-Weboberfläche ausgeblendet. - Die Berichtsantwort enthält jetzt Start- und Enddaten. Das ist wichtig, wenn Sie beim Generieren von Berichten relative Datumsangaben verwenden (z. B. 
today,yesterday,firstDayOfMonth-1m). Die Antwort enthält jetzt den von Ihnen angeforderten Zeitraum. 
Bekannte Probleme
Das Feld currency in Berichten wird in dieser Version nicht unterstützt.
Version 1.3
In dieser Version werden die folgenden Funktionen eingeführt:
- Benachrichtigungen abrufen
 - Die Möglichkeit, Metadaten für Messwerte und Dimensionen abzurufen.
 - Berichte können in der lokalen Zeitzone des Kontos erstellt werden.
 
Bekannte Probleme
Das Feld currency in Berichten wird in dieser Version nicht unterstützt.
Version 1.2
In dieser Version werden die folgenden Funktionen eingeführt:
- Anzeigendesigns können abgerufen werden.
 - Die Möglichkeit, die im Frontend definierten gespeicherten Berichte abzurufen und auszuführen.
 
Bekannte Probleme
Das Feld currency in Berichten wird in dieser Version nicht unterstützt.
Version 1.1
In dieser Version werden die folgenden Funktionen eingeführt:
- Die Möglichkeit, Konten aufzulisten, auf die der Nutzer Zugriff hat
 - Die Möglichkeit, einen GET-Aufruf für ein bestimmtes Konto auszuführen
 - GET-Aufrufe für Anzeigenblöcke und benutzerdefinierte Channels sind möglich.
 - Die Möglichkeit, die Verbindungen zwischen Anzeigenblöcken und benutzerdefinierten Channels zu ermitteln
 - Benutzerdefinierte Channels enthalten mehr Daten zu Targeting-Informationen
 
Außerdem können Sie jetzt entweder über Ihr Standardkonto oder über ein bestimmtes Konto auf Daten zugreifen.
Bekannte Probleme
Das Feld currency in Berichten wird in dieser Version nicht unterstützt.
Version 1
Dies ist die erste Version der API. Sie können damit unter anderem Anzeigeclients, Anzeigenblöcke, benutzerdefinierte Channels und URL-Channels abrufen sowie Berichte erstellen.
Bekannte Probleme
Das Feld currency in Berichten wird in dieser Version nicht unterstützt.